{"count":1,"message":"Results returned successfully","results":[{"odiNumber":11502121,"manufacturer":"Subaru of America, Inc.","crash":false,"fire":false,"numberOfInjuries":0,"numberOfDeaths":0,"dateOfIncident":"01/17/2023","dateComplaintFiled":"01/17/2023","vin":"JF1VBAF62N9","components":"ENGINE","summary":"The fa24 engine for this car uses an RTV gasket to seal the oil pan. Subaru ended up using too much RTV sealant on this engine which ended up causing pieces of RTV to fall off inside of the oil pan. This can cause a clog in the oil pickup which may result in oil starvation for the engine. If this happens in traffic and the motor blows up, it could cause a collision. Subaru doesn't have any active service or recalls for this issue and it has been known to happen on the BRZ and Toyota 86 which both use the same engine. You can see online that others have dropped the oil pans on their fa24s and found RTV fluid in their oil pan. Recently, RallySport Direct on YoutTube release a video detailing them dropping the oil pan on a 22 WRX and found large pieces of RTV clogging the oil pickup. If Subaru doesn't address this issue, it can affect many vehicles on the road.","products":[{"type":"Vehicle","productYear":"2022","productMake":"SUBARU","productModel":"WRX","manufacturer":"Subaru of America, Inc."}]}]}
